Wen Yue was not worried that Wen Weiming would not agree.

Wen Weiming only had two daughters. Wen Wan was of marriageable age, while Wen Jing was still too young to make a difference. If he didn't agree, then all his decades of hard work would be in vain for the sake of his clan.

Wen Yue sent Wen Weiming to the carriage, then turned back and met her husband Qi Lanting head-on.

When the couple looked at each other, Qi Lanting felt relieved, as if he had taken a reassurance pill. "Did the second brother agree?"

Wen Yue was both happy and worried, with a complicated expression, "How could he have any other solution?"

The good news is that there is hope for Wen Wan to marry into the Qi family.

What I am worried about is Wen Weiming's health.

They were born of the same mother, so it would be a lie to say that there was no brotherly love between Wen Weiming and Wen Yue. Seeing Wen Weiming's emaciated appearance with sunken eyes, Wen Yue felt a pang of heartache.

It is not a legitimate thing for an eldest sister to calculate her brother's inheritance.

But seeing that the second brother was already dying, she couldn't let the tribe members get away with it.

Since the huge fortune earned by the second daughter will eventually be divided up by others, why not just give it to her to Qi's family?
At least Wen Wan is her biological niece, and she will never treat Wen Wan unfairly.

The second child is just stubborn.

Qi Lanting looked very pleased with himself. "The second brother only has two daughters, and he loves Wen Wan the most. He will never let her marry a boy with unknown background. Moreover, the clan members are pressing hard now. How can he have time to look for other families for Wen Wan? Right now, the second brother... is helpless."

Wen Yue rubbed her temples and said weakly, "Alas, it's like this... I have offended my brother after all. I saw that he didn't look very happy when he left just now. I'm afraid he also realized what we were planning."

"You're just too soft-hearted. Even if he notices, what can we do? The situation is beyond our control now, and Second Brother Wen has no choice! I think... we need to add fuel to the fire and have the clan members go to the Wen family and cause trouble a few more times. Then Second Brother will beg his daughter to marry into our family."

Qi Lanting was very proud of himself and felt that he had planned everything perfectly.

Thinking about how Wen Laoer had worked hard for half his life, and in the end he had to make wedding dresses for him, Qi Lanting couldn't help but feel happy.

He had been coveting Wen Laoer's house in the city for a long time.

Wen Yue sighed, "You decide."

Wen Weiming got on the carriage, unable to contain his anger any longer, and punched the carriage wall. Blood instantly flowed from the bones of his right hand. "This is too much! This is too much!"

"The Qi family... they're forcing me to have no descendants! They've got a brilliant plan. They're letting Wen Wan marry into the family and take the family fortune with her, so they can reap the benefits! I, Wen Weiming, have worked hard for most of my life, and in the end, all this wealth belongs to the Qi family!"

Wen Weiming didn't know who of the Wen Yue couple had started this, so he cursed Wen Yue as well. "I used to think of her as my closest sibling, but I never knew she was so treacherous and foolish as to help her in-laws deal with me!"

"They bullied me, Wen Weiming, because he was sick, and started threatening me, saying they would never mistreat Wan Niang. Bah, what a heartless and treacherous couple!"

Wen Weiming was already ill, and due to the anger, his abdomen was churning and he vomited a mouthful of black blood with a "wow".

The old servant was frightened and worried that Wen Weiming would get hurt, so he kept calling out for Wen Wan.

Wen Wan was delayed for a while at Qi Guili's place, so she came out late.

As soon as she walked out of the Qi family's gate, she heard the angry voice of Old Man Wen in the carriage. She thought something was wrong, and as soon as she lifted the curtain, she saw blood on Wen Weiming's lips.

"Father!" Wen Wan grabbed Doctor Yan and stuffed him into the carriage, "Doctor, please take a look at my father——"

Doctor Yan immediately boarded the carriage and carefully felt Wen Weiming's pulse. Wen Weiming leaned against the carriage wall, his face full of wry smiles. "Don't be afraid, Wanniang. Daddy is fine."

Wen Wan pretended not to notice, her heart pounding in her throat, only looking at Doctor Yan. "It's nothing, the blood you vomited actually cleared the stagnation in your lungs, a blessing in disguise."

Only then did Wen Wan breathe a sigh of relief.

She had a premonition about the Qi family's affairs, but now seeing Wen Weiming injured, Wen Wan couldn't help but feel distressed.

Wen Weiming still didn't give up and asked Doctor Yan again: "Did you go in and take Qi Laosan's pulse just now? Is he really sick or is he faking it?"

Doctor Yan scoffed. "What's wrong? The child is as healthy as a calf. I'm afraid he can live for a hundred years."

Wen Weiming's face turned pale in an instant.

The Qi family...from the very beginning...had no intention of fulfilling the marriage contract.

What serious illness, what studying, they were just means to control Wen Weiming.

Wen Wan couldn't bear to look at her adopted father's expression any longer. After Doctor Yan got off the carriage, she took Old Man Wen's hand and comforted him, "Father, there's no need to be angry with them. It's better to recognize their true colors now than to marry them later. Besides, the Qi family doesn't agree to Qi Sanlang marrying into our Wen family. Does that mean there are no other men in the world?"

Father Wen shook his head, "Son, you don't know, the Qi family has calculated the timing perfectly. They are certain that we won't be able to find another boy to marry into their family in a short period of time, so they are so confident!"

Old Man Wen's anger flared up again as he spoke. "How hateful! Every time my eldest sister comes here, she goes back empty-handed. I've treated her and the children well, yet she tricked me like this! If I hadn't worried about her and the elders ganging up on you a hundred years from now, I wouldn't have dared to offend her. I would have flipped the table and left!"

"That hateful Qi Guili is a piece of shit. He can't tell right from wrong, good from evil, and he actually colluded with his parents to bully my Wen family! He used to call me uncle and called himself a scholar. Pah! I'm not even dead yet, and they're already plotting against my entire Wen family!"

Old Man Wen scolded harshly.

Wenwan, however, couldn't empathize with him.

In her previous life, after she was diagnosed with stomach cancer, her boyfriend of six years left her.

He cried bitterly when he left: Wen Wan, I love you, but I love myself more.

It felt like he was the one who was dumped, not Wen Wan.

The perpetrator can become the victim by just crying a few times insincerely.

Wen Weiming lowered his head again and saw the little gadget in Wen Wan's hand. He knew it was made by Qi Sanlang. His heart sank, fearing that Wen Wan and Qi Sanlang still had feelings for each other. "What are you holding in your hand?"

Wen Wan looked down and realized it was the straw dragonfly Qi Guili had given her. However, she had been so nervous when Old Man Wen vomited blood that she hadn't noticed the dragonfly's limbs had been broken by her.

Wen Wan threw the dragonfly out of the car window without hesitation, as if she didn't care at all that it was a gift from Qi Jia Sanlang.

Wen Weiming was surprised.

In the past, the daughter treasured everything Sanlang gave her. But now she discards it like a worn-out shoe. Does this mean that the daughter has come to her senses and no longer misses Qijia Sanlang?

"Father, I've actually been prepared for this." Wen Wan spoke softly, "Madam Liu said there's a hunter in the West Mountain who's handsome and a decent man, but his family is a little poor, so his marriage has been delayed. To the outside, Madam Liu returned to her parents' home with a letter of release as a concubine, but in reality, she was helping me find a man from a nearby county."

In the Chen Dynasty, few women arranged their own marriages, and respectable families would not let concubines negotiate marriages. However, given the current situation of the Wen family, what respectability could they talk about?
